Royal-Thomian annual hockey clash today

The sixth annual hockey encounter for the Orville Abeynaike Trophy between Royal and S. Thomas', will take place this evening at 4.30 p.m., at the Astro Turf Grounds, Reid Avenue, Colombo 7. The old boys match at 3.30 p.m. will precede the main match.
From its inaugural trophy match S. Thomas' have consecutively won all the encounters for the past five years.
But the Royalists have done well in recent years to narrow down the margin of defeat.
For the reason that in the year 2003 Royal lost by the odd 1 goal to Nil, and last year it lost 3 goals to 2. The difference being a solitary goal, and so a keen tussle will be on today on the Astro Turf. Royal College will be led by G. Dissanayake and S. Thomas' by D.N. Karunaratne.
In the old boys match the two captains are Royal - Manju Guanwardena and S. Thomas' - Mininda Morahela.

Chief Minister- Eastern Province, Sivanesathurai Chandrakanthan better know as ‘Pillayan’, on Wednesday suggested that the powers of the provincial councils should be strengthened with more powers to the provinces.

Sivanesathurai Chandrakanthan addressing the Lessons Learnt & Reconciliation Commission
“Government should allow to fully exercise the powers vested in the provincial councils,” the Chief minister told the Lessons Learnt & Reconciliation Commission. “That is the only way we can win the hearts and minds of the people,” he said.
He said that, in the past, mistakes made by successive leaders had paved the way for the creation of armed groups. “This is an appropriate time for the government to take correct action to safeguard the rights of the citizens of this country, as the government currently has a two-thirds majority in Parliament,” he said.
“There are land issues in the Eastern Province. In the past, permits have been issued for lands in the Eastern Province, but due to the war situation, people fled the area. If those people return and demand their land, we will not be able to allocate the same land, as they have been already allocated to other persons.
“However, if persons in possession of the original deeds, return and demand their land, we can make arrangements to get back the land for them,” he said. “I am doing my best to solve the land issues in the area, and have visited some of the locations personally. I am working towards restoring ethnic harmony,” Mr. Chandrakanthan said.
Responding to a question about his reaction to Muslims chased away from the north, he said that Muslims were not chased from the east, but that he was willing to submit a full report on land issues to the commission.
“In Sampur, there are about 6,000 people living in camps. The coal power project backed by the Indians is coming up. We will benefit economically from the project, as the sea is deeper than in the Hambantota port area. But the people want to return to their original lands. I am trying to resettle them in other areas. However, if the people insist on returning to their old areas, it is only the President who can take a decision on the matter,” he said.
“In the 1990’s, the armed forces committed atrocities against the people. That made me join the LTTE. I have seen many bodies. In 1990, there was a group who killed people by slashing them with knives. Three of my classmates too were taken away. Some who worshipped seeking their release were shot. Therefore, the politicians who were responsible for these incidents should tender their apologies,” he added.
He was asked whether he shouldn’t tender an apology for the killing of 600 policemen in the east.
“As a former member of the LTTE, I can tender an apology. They were killed in June 1990, while I joined the LTTE in 1991. Therefore, it is not proper for me to tender an apology. The then leader Karuna (Vinayagamoorthy Muralitharan, currently a minister in the government) could tender his apology.
“Initially, S.J.V. Chelvanayagam formed the Thamil Arasu Katchchi, and signed a pact with former Prime Minister S.W.R.D. Bandaranaike. But J.R. Jayewardene who was in the opposition opposed it.
He claimed the Tamils will have more rights and therefore, the pact was not implemented. Thereafter, former Prime Minister Dudley Senanayake and Chelavanayagam signed another agreement. That too did not work out. Later, the District Development Councils were formed, and that too failed. The Tamil people never asked for separation, but opposition politicians gave distorted versions of the Tamil demands. As a result, there were atrocities against the Tamils. When the Tamil parties failed to fulfill their aspirations, armed Tamil groups sprang up. There were differences among the groups, which resulted in rival killings. Finally, the LTTE became the recognized group to achieve the Eelam goal”.
He said that, after former president Jaywardene formed the government, the provincial council system was introduced with the assistance of the Indians.
“The person who opposed the Bandaranaike-Chelvanayagam pact, eventually went beyond that and entered into an agreement with India to set up the provincial council system,” he said.
“However, then President Ranasinghe Premadasa opposed the provincial council system, and captured power. He provided the LTTE with weapons and sabotaged the functioning of the provincial councils.

I feel that former leaders Jayawardene and Premadasa betrayed the country,” he added.

Darren Aronofsky’s upcoming psychological/supernatural/who-the-hell-know-what thriller Black Swan has opened the Venice Film Festival. Which means early reviews, and some new images.
Of the five reviews so far, 80% are positive. Here’s what the critics are saying
Variety -
“A wicked, sexy and ultimately devastating study of a young dancer’s all-consuming ambition, “Black Swan” serves as a fascinating complement to Darren Aronofsky’s “The Wrestler,” trading the grungy world of a broken-down fighter for the more upscale but no less brutal sphere of professional ballet. Centerstage stands Natalie Portman, whose courageous turn lays bare the myriad insecurities…”
Daily Telegraph (UK) -
“Powerful, gripping and always intriguing, it also features a lead performance from Natalie Portman that elevates her from a substantial leading actress to major star likely to be lifting awards in the near future. …Tchaikovsky’s music takes on an unsettling quality as Nina’s descent progresses, all the way to the disturbing but perfect ending. Black Swan is an exhilarating if uneasy ride, one that could deliver Aronofsky his second Golden Lion here in three years. 4/5″
Hollywood Reporter -
“Trying to coax a horror-thriller out of the world of ballet doesn’t begin to work for Darren Aronofsky. …Black Swan is an instant guilty pleasure, a gorgeously shot, visually complex film whose badness is what’s so good about it… Certain to divide audiences.”

Oh ! Prison... it´s a pity. It isn’t a place favorable for you sir. But there are people stays in peace than the outside. In year 2008 I was sent into the prison because of deserting the Army (leaving the job as a military doctor. I left the military during Ranil-Prabha peace pact time in 2003. I willingly joined military in 1996 just after my medical degree, merely to serve the soldiers. I served for 7 difficult years treating soldiers in various operational areas, mostly during Jayasikuru operation and several debacles such as Kilinochchi, EPS etc. ) I was astonished the worst sentence given by the military, but convinced myself as I breached military regulations. I didn´t develop any personal hatred against General Fonseka who personally took my case into consideration and willingly put me in civilian jail for more than 3 months. All my siblings and friends started cursing General Fonseka giving me such an awful punishment. Yet, I thought it in a different angle. He really did his job and no favors. This was 2008 when he was leading our army against LTTE rascals. I continued to respect him during the time of imprisonment as he was doing a great job for my country. Still, he is a real son of mother Lanka. Nobody can destroy that image even though he was sent to the prison. Unfortunately he sent me to Civilian Jail where I met underworld gangs, thieves, murderers, robbers, rapists etc. I was thinking that why they didn´t sent me to a military prison. Now I feel it was better that they sent me over there. People in the prison are a mirror image of the civilian society. They started taking care of me. As a matter of fact, most of the high-fi fellows sentenced to the prison never enter into prison wards but get treatments in the prison hospital. This is the reality. I never tried to use my connections and influences towards that destination if I had any. People who were in the prison never purposely ill-treated me though there were some painful incidents. Some found paper articles written about me during the battle time, working as a military doctor. At the end of the period I really felt bad to leave the place. Wlikada prison is a disgusting place. I never hope a person must go there, it is a real mess. There are lots and lots of irregularities being done by gangs inside. But the place I was sent secondarily, Padukka- open prison was a great relief for me. I set my mind to "go through every second of my time POSITIVELY”. It´s so unfortunate, that I met lots of military personal imprisoned for several years because of Desertion. Some deserters were forced to take the decision due to family matters, personal illnesses etc. There had been no imprisonments for some military men who did the same offense and no even a court-marshal for commanders who cowardly withdrew some of the big military camps killing hundreds of officers and thousands of soldiers. And no court cases for some ex-ministers who were involved in corruptions. There was a time that the government did operations to win elections. Just to recover 1km area Army had to sacrifice hundreds of casualties. I am not here to support HE the president for his decision. But it’s very apparent that the decision is biased. Honestly, General Fonseka’s extraordinary personality and psychology boomeranged into himself. He was a brilliant military man. But as a human being, he would not score much marks from people who have closely worked with him. He is a real rude person. Of course that’s the very reason he led the army such a remarkable way to neutralize the enemies. A priest cannot do that. Nevertheless, it is not an unknown thing there were several staff absentees during his stay in military hospital after experiencing injuries of the blast in Army HQ because of his cruelty. "If" general fonseka did breach the law, he deserves the punishment. But there must be more transparency on the issue as he was one of the key members led our national forces to eradicate LTTE terrorism. His name must have written in golden letters. But he himself shares the responsibility for the disaster what happened to him today.

  here's how to do it,

Step 01: Register a domain name

Domain name is your identity on the web. For example this web site’s identity is “antharjalaya.com”. You need to use a domain registrar in order to purchase the domain name. It will typically cost you less than $10.
I would advise you to buy a “dot com” name instead of other extensions. Try adding a hyphen and seperate the words if your desired name is not available in dot com format.
i.e
If startforextrading.com is not available try registering start-forex-trading.com
If it is impossible to buy your domain name in the dot com format try dot org or dot net. If your target market is limited to a specific country buying a country specific domain is also advisable.
I have posted a complete step by step tutorial on how to buy a domain name in one of my earlier blog post. Read it here.

Step 02 : Create your web site.

Make sure you present your web site with a high level of quality, functionality, and professionalism. You can hire a web designer if you you do not have any previous experience. This is the most common approach adopted by many web entrepreneurs and this is the easiest way to get your web site up and running.
Hiring a web designer will cost you approximately $100- $1500 and higher price web designers are not always the best. So, have a very good look at their portfolio before making any upfront payment.
Designing your own web site can be a quite entertaining experience
if you are a quick learner.You need to learn little HTML but it is not difficult considering all the resources available online.
You can use a simple text editor to write your HTML pages, or you can utilize on of the many free HTML editors available on the web.
I use Adobe Dreamweaver software as it does all the HTML coding for me. But you are still required to learn the basics of HTML. If you know how to use MS word, it will not be difficult to use Dreamweaver.

Website templates.

One easy way to get your website design is to begin with a template. Website templates are Semi finished web pages that have been predesigned and assembled with all the graphics and necessary code needed to get a web site online quickly.
The above is an example for a fashion/ clothing template. You can just edit the text and make it your own web design.
There are many places on the web where you can buy templates, or get them for free. An important aspect of using a template is to utilize as much customization as possible. For a startup company, a template is a good way to save some money and focus on keeping up a positive cash flow.
Many web hosts provide Free web site templates. Keep this fact in mind when you are choosing a web host. If you sign up with a quality host You will find many premium designs for free.

Step 03: Choose a web hosting plan

In order for your website to be available to anyone at anytime, you need to host it with a web host. It is a web server leased to you by a web hosting company. Basically, web hosting provides a way for people to access your web site through the internet. Without it, there would be no way for people to see the page.
There are several thousand web hosting companies out there to choose from. It’s best to chose a web hosting company based on a recommendation. You need to look for following details before making this very important decision.
1. Reliability and speed of access
2. Bandwidth allocated to you.
3. Disk space given to you.
4. Their Technical support.
5. Availability of FTP, PHP, Perl, SSI, .htaccess, telnet, SSH, and MySQL.
6. Email, Autoresponders, POP3, Mail Forwarding.
7. Control Panel type.
8. Multiple Domain Hosting and Subdomains.
9. Price
10.Monthly/Quarterly/Annual Payment Plans.

Step 04 : Upload your site to the web.

There are 2 ways of uploading your web site files to Internet. The most common method is via FTP. FTP allows you to quickly transfer many files and I am using the FREE software “filezila” for this purpose.
Another method is to use the File Manager within your cPanel control panel, which has an upload feature which allows you to browse your computer and select the files you wish to upload.
